Séminaire Doctoral  Une "Europe de la santé" : passé et présent

L’année 2020 a été marquée par une situation d’urgence pandémique inédite et une reconfiguration politique européenne majeure. Elle pose la question d’une Europe sanitaire et sociale dans le monde globalisé des pandémies. Pour penser la situation actuelle, le projet propose un retour aux sources de la construction européenne sectorielle : le projet oublié d’une Communauté Européenne de la Santé (CES) entre 1948 et 1957. Le séminaire cherche à contextualiser cette initiative de politiques et relations internationales, sanitaires et sociales par trois entrées interdisciplinaires :

  1. l’analyse des données épidémiologiques et de santé publique de l’époque ;
  2. une analyse en termes de science politique de la dynamique de la construction européenne comme échelon intermédiaire entre les autorités nationales et les organisations internationales émergentes ;
  3. une entrée par le droit qui combinera une analyse des procès des crimes de guerre médicaux, la question de l’épuration et des liens d’intérêts et des continuités professionnels dans le secteur de la santé et celle d’un droit médical international.

Le séminaire suivra les trois axes du projet en interdisciplinaire : santé, sciences politiques et droit en complétant les travaux engagés.

Mobil'ITI grants

ITI MAKErS offers 2 support schemes for the outgoing mobility of doctoral students:

  •    Living a research experience in a laboratory abroad
  •    Participating in international events (summer schools, colloquia, workshops, conferences, etc.)
